Why Taghazout Is Famous for Surfing

Taghazout is known for having some of the best surf spots in Morocco and Africa. The region receives consistent Atlantic swells, especially between October and April, making it a paradise for surfers.

Some of the most famous surf spots include:

Anchor Point

The most legendary wave in Morocco. Long right-hand point break waves perfect for intermediate and advanced surfers.

Banana Point

A fun and friendly wave suitable for beginners and intermediates.

Devil’s Rock

One of the best surf spots for beginners learning at Morocco surf camps.

Panoramas

A mellow surf spot near the village ideal for surf lessons and long rides.

The diversity of waves is one reason why Taghazout surf camps are so popular with travelers worldwide.

Best Time to Visit Taghazout Surf Camps

The best surfing season in Taghazout depends on your skill level.

October to April

Perfect for intermediate and advanced surfers looking for bigger waves and stronger swells.

May to September

Great for beginners and travelers wanting smaller waves, warm weather, and relaxed surf sessions.

Taghazout enjoys over 300 sunny days per year, making it one of the best year-round surf destinations in the world.
